What is a Cooker Hood Island?

A cooker hood island, commonly referred to as a range hood or Island Hoods Kitchen extractor hood, is a ventilation device set up above a kitchen island-- where cooking surfaces, such as varieties or cooktops, are placed. Its primary function is to remove air-borne grease, smoke, steam, and smells created during cooking, making sure a cleaner and more enjoyable cooking environment.

Kinds Of Cooker Hood Islands

Cooker hood islands can be found in various styles and performances:

  1. Ducted Hoods: These hoods vent air outside through ductwork. They are typically more reliable at getting rid of smoke and smells.
  2. Ductless Hoods: Also called recirculating hoods, these systems filter the air and recirculate it back into the kitchen. They are much easier to set up however might be less effective in removing odors.
  3. Wall-Mounted Hoods: These are set up against the wall nearby to the island and are a popular choice for maintaining an open kitchen idea.
  4. Island Hoods: These are developed particularly to hang from the ceiling above an island cooktop, supplying sufficient protection.

Considerations for Choosing a Cooker Hood Island

Choosing the best cooker hood island requires cautious idea. Here are a number of factors to consider:

  1. Size: The hood ought to be larger than the cooking surface for optimum efficiency.
  2. Height: Proper installation height ensures reliable ventilation while preserving comfortable cooking conditions.
  3. Style: Choose a style that complements your kitchen design, whether contemporary, conventional, or commercial.
  4. CFM Rating (Cubic Feet per Minute): This measures the hood's ventilation power. Greater CFM rankings are typically needed for high-heat cooking styles.
  5. Sound Levels: Consider the decibel rating of the hood, specifically if sound is a concern in the kitchen island extractor hood.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. What is the ideal height for a cooker hood island?

Typically, the ideal height for a cooker hood island hoods Kitchen is between 28 to 36 inches above the cooktop. The specific height might differ based upon the type of hood and the kitchen's ceiling height.

2. How frequently should I clean my cooker hood island?

It is recommended to clean the cooker hood and its filters monthly. For heavily used kitchen areas, more regular cleaning may be needed to ensure ideal efficiency.

3. Can I set up a cooker hood island myself?

While some might try DIY setup, it is recommended to hire an expert electrician or professional, especially if ductwork is required. Inappropriate installation can cause inadequacies or safety threats.

4. How do ductless cooker hoods work?

Ductless cooker hoods utilize filters to cleanse the air before recirculating it back into the kitchen. Activated charcoal filters are often used to take in odors, while grease filters trap airborne grease particles.

Maintenance Tips

To lengthen the life of a cooker hood island and guarantee it runs efficiently, regular maintenance is essential:

  • Regular Cleaning: Wipe down the outside and clean the filters as defined by the maker.
  • Check Lightbulbs: If the unit has built-in lights, change any burnt-out bulbs promptly.
  • Assessment: Periodically examine ducted systems for blockages or obstructions in the ductwork.
